US soldier shoots civilians after Kabul blast
Kabul, June 16: A US soldier opened fire at the scene of a suicide bombing in the Afghan capital today, killing one civilian and wounding another, police said.
Ali Shah Paktiawal, chief of Kabul police's criminal branch, described the shooting as a 'mistake'. He gave no more details.
A US military spokesman said US-led coalition forces were still looking into the incident.
Paktiawal said the soldier had opened fire after a suicide bomber attacked a military-civilian convoy on the outskirts of Kabul, killing four civilians and wounding five people, including a foreign soldier.
